The Hidden Impact of Humidity
As we enter the humid season in India, a new study published in Science Advances highlights a concerning link between hot and humid days during pregnancy and the growth of children. The findings are eye-opening, to say the least.
A Different Kind of Heat
What makes this study particularly fascinating is its focus on 'wet-bulb globe temperature' (WBGT), a measure that takes into account not just air temperature but also humidity, sunlight, and wind. This comprehensive approach paints a clearer picture of how heat actually feels to the human body. And the results are alarming.
The Impact on Growth
During the critical final trimester of pregnancy, a rise in humid-heat days is associated with a significant decrease in a child's height-for-age score, a standard indicator of healthy growth. This impact is almost four times greater than what is observed when considering temperature alone. In other words, the humidity factor cannot be ignored.
Timing is Crucial
The study also highlights the importance of timing. The damage is not spread evenly throughout pregnancy. Instead, it clusters at two critical periods: the earliest weeks when the fetus is most vulnerable, and the final trimester when the strain on the mother is at its peak. This timing suggests a complex interplay between environmental conditions and the delicate balance of prenatal development.
The Bigger Picture
What many people don't realize is that this study has far-reaching implications. By 2050, the projections suggest that humid heat could lead to millions of additional cases of stunted growth in South Asia. This is a staggering number, and it highlights the urgent need to address this hidden threat.
A Call for Action
The study's findings challenge the way we approach heat-related risks. Current heat action plans in India, for example, are primarily focused on temperature and urban areas, with little consideration for humidity or the unique vulnerabilities of pregnant women. This gap in our preparedness could have severe consequences for the health and well-being of future generations.
